The Role
- Assisting experienced surveyors with Management and Refurbishment and Demolition (R and D) asbestos surveys
- Learning to identify and assess asbestos-containing materials in accordance with HSG264
- Collecting bulk samples and recording accurate site information
- Producing asbestos survey reports with full training provided
- Travelling across the Central Belt of Scotland
- Working across commercial, industrial, domestic, education, and public sector properties
- Developing your knowledge of asbestos legislation and industry best practice
- Gradually progressing towards independently managing your own surveying workload
- Ensuring all work complies with HSE guidance and company procedures
